Key AI Features for UK Marketers
Mailchimp's AI suite, now branded under "Intuit Assist," integrates deeply into the platform.
1. Generative AI for Content
Struggling with writer's block? Mailchimp's AI can write subject lines, headlines, and entire email body text.
- Subject Line Helper: Scores your subject lines and suggests improvements based on open-rate data.
- Content Optimizer: Analyzes your draft and benchmarks it against millions of successful campaigns, suggesting tone and layout tweaks.
2. Predictive Segmentation
Don't just blast your whole list. AI analyzes contact behavior to create smart segments.
- Purchase Likelihood: Identifies contacts most likely to buy again soon, perfect for VIP offers.
- Customer Lifetime Value (CLV): Estimates the future value of a customer, helping you prioritize retention efforts.
3. Send Time Optimization
AI determines the exact moment an individual contact is most likely to check their inbox.
- Individualized Delivery: Instead of sending at 9 AM for everyone, one person might receive it at 8:15 AM and another at 7:30 PM.
- UK/Global Time Zones: Automatically adjusts for recipients across different locations.

UK Pricing & Plans
Mailchimp's pricing is based on contact count, which can get pricey as you grow.
- Free: Basic email features, limited to 500 contacts. Good for starting.
- Essentials: Removes branding, adds A/B testing.
- Standard: The sweet spot for AI. Includes Send Time Optimization, Predictive Segmentation, and Customer Journeys.
- Premium: Advanced multivariate testing and priority support.
